Honours English Language and Literature

The Honours English program consists of 20 full-credit courses (or equivalent), including a minimum of 12 but no more than 14 credits in English. At most six credits may be at the 100 level (of which no more than one and a half may be in English courses).

Required Courses:
EN122* (or, with permission of the Department, EN118 and EN130);
At least three of: EN272*, EN352*, EN453*, EN454*.
At least three of: EN256*, EN258* (or EN462*), EN355*, EN357*.
At least two of: EN218, EN265, EN266, EN267, EN269, of which at least one must be either EN267 or EN269.
A minimum of two credits distributed over two or more of the following lists:
(a) EN291, EN302, FS241, FS242, FS341
(b) EN211, EN212, EN225, EN325
(c) EN203, EN207, EN233, EN234, EN322, EN326
At least two but no more than four additional credits consisting of any English courses not already taken.

Note: For students wishing to graduate with a degree in Honours English with the Theatre minor, the minimum number of English credits required is 12, and the maximum number of credits in both English and Theatre courses is 15; for students graduating with Honours English with the Theatre major, the minimum number of English credits required is 12, and the maximum number of credits in both English and Theatre courses is 17.
